Cause of disease mediates the relationship between socioeconomic status and laryngotracheal stenosis outcomes: A retrospective cohort study in South Africa
2026-07-12
Abstract excerpt
<title>Abstract</title> <p> Background Mechanisms linking socioeconomic disadvantage to laryngotracheal stenosis (LTS) outcomes remain unclear. We investigated whether cause of disease mediates the relationship between socioeconomic status (SES) and LTS outcomes. Methods We conducted a retrospective cohort study of 126 consecutive LTS patients (2005–2024) in South Africa. SES was measured using an adapted Soci...
